Frank was born in 31 November 1886 at Ashwell, Hertfordshire, the only son of Joseph and Mary (nee Bryant) Albon, a brewery labourer and a laundress of Ashwell. He was a pupil at the Merchant Taylors School in Ashwell.
Reginald was the eldest son of Ellis and Annie (nee Kingsley) Anderson. Ellis was a bootmaker and beer retailer at the Australian Cow pub1 in High Street Ashwell. Reginald was a pupil of the Merchant Taylors School in Ashwell.
Edward was the second son of Edward Smith Ashby and Agnes Selina (nee Woodcock) Ashby, born in Harston, Cambridgeshire on 5 September 1886. He was a pupil at the Merchant Taylors School in Ashwell.
Eli was the third son of Samuel and Ruth (nee Hayden) Bullard, born on 8 January 1886 at Thriplow. He was a pupil at the Merchant Taylors School in Ashwell, Hertfordshire.
Lewis was born in Southills, Bedfordshire in 1886, the only son of William and Annie (nee Robinson) Daniels. Lewis was a pupil of the Merchant Taylors School, Ashwell.
Harry was born on 23 December 1886, the fifth son of Leopold and Mary Ann Elizabeth (nee Bonfield) at Ashwell, Hertfordshire. He was a pupil at the Merchant Taylors School in Ashwell.
Frederick was the third son of John and Martha (nee Scoot) Sheldrick, born at Thriplow, Cambridgeshire on 12 October 1886. He was a pupil at the Merchant Taylor School in Ashwell, Hertfordshire.
Frederick was born in Ashwell, Hertfordshire on 17 October 1886, the fifth son of James and Mary Anne Alice (nee Austin). He was a pupil at the Merchant Taylors School in Ashwell.
